From: Are serum-free and xeno-free culture conditions ideal for large scale clinical grade expansion of Wharton’s jelly derived mesenchymal stem cells? A comparative study

Figure 1

Growth kinetics and immunophenotype. A,B,C) Morphology pictures of WJ-MSCs grown in serum-containing and serum-free media, passage 1; D,E,F) Pictures of WJ- MSCs grown in serum-containing and serum-free media, passage 5; G,H) Total cell number and cumulative population doublings obtained upon culturing WJ-MSCs in serum-containing and serum-free media, up to passage 5; I) Percentage expression of MSC positive and negative makers, expressed on WJ-MSCs cultured in three different media. WJ-MSCs, Wharton’s jelly-mesenchymal stem cells.
